About Garden International School (GIS)

GIS welcomes students from many nationalities and provides a broad British-style education with academic, co-curricular and personal-development opportunities.

  • International day school
  • Ages 3–18
  • Main campus in Mont Kiara
  • Early Years Centre in Desa Sri Hartamas
  • UK/British curriculum

Vision: To develop confident, capable and internationally minded young people.

Mission: To provide a high-quality international education with strong academic and personal development.

Academic Structure at Garden International School (GIS)

  • Early Years

    • Nursery and Reception
    • Foundation learning
  • Primary School (Years 1–6)

    • Broad UK curriculum
    • Academic and creative development
  • Secondary School (Years 7–11)

    • Years 7–9 broad curriculum
    • IGCSE in Years 10–11
  • Sixth Form (Years 12–13)

    • A Level pathway
    • University preparation

Garden International School (GIS) Tuition Fees

YEAR GROUPANNUAL / PERIODNOTES
NurseryRM 17,480 / term3 terms
ReceptionRM 20,780 / term3 terms
Year 1RM 28,530 / term3 terms
Years 10–13RM 42,290 / term3 terms

Admissions Process

How to Apply

  1. Review the application information.
  2. Submit the online application and required documents.
  3. Complete assessment/diagnostic and interview as applicable.
  4. Receive admission decision and offer.
  5. Complete enrolment and payment.

Entry Requirements

  • Age/year-group placement follows school cut-off dates.
  • English is the language of instruction.
  • Applicants are assessed for readiness to access the curriculum.
